Map awareness is crucial for success in CSGO, as it allows players to anticipate enemy movements and make informed decisions during gameplay. One of the top tips is to regularly study the maps you play on. Familiarize yourself with callouts, choke points, and common hiding spots. This knowledge not only helps you navigate the map efficiently but also allows you to communicate effectively with your team. Additionally, use resources like YouTube and online guides to watch professional players and understand their strategies on various maps.
Another essential tip for enhancing your map awareness in CSGO is to constantly keep an eye on the minimap. Regularly glancing at the minimap can give you critical information about your teammates' positions and any potential threats. Make it a habit to check the minimap every few seconds to ensure you're always aware of the bigger picture. Furthermore, try to listen for audio cues, such as footsteps and gunfire, as these noises can help you deduce enemy placements and plan your next move. By combining these techniques, you can significantly improve your game and outsmart your opponents.

Map awareness is a crucial skill in CSGO, yet many players overlook key aspects that could significantly enhance their gameplay. One of the most common mistakes is failing to regularly check the minimap. The minimap provides vital information about teammates' positions and potential enemy movements. Make it a habit to glance at your minimap every few seconds to stay updated on the battlefield dynamics. Additionally, neglecting to communicate with your team about enemy locations is another pitfall. Effective communication can turn the tide of a match, so make sure to relay significant information whenever possible.
Another frequent error is not utilizing sound cues to your advantage. In CSGO, sound plays a critical role in map awareness. Players often ignore footsteps, bomb plant sounds, and reload noises, which can provide essential insights into enemy whereabouts. To improve your awareness, invest in a good pair of headphones and learn to differentiate between various sound effects. Lastly, many players do not take the time to learn the maps thoroughly. Understanding key locations, typical fight areas, and potential hiding spots can greatly improve your decision-making. Consider reviewing maps and practicing them to ensure you're not missing out on opportunities during a match.
